The Sun Hydraulics WFP (Material Number: WFP) is a line mount hydraulic manifold designed for versatile fluid control applications. It features a ninety-degree body type with no specific interface, making it adaptable for various hydraulic systems. The manifold includes two mounting holes with a diameter of 0.34 inches (8.6 mm) that go through the body, accommodating secure installations. This model is equipped with one open cavity, specifically designed to fit a T8A cavity and has a port size of 1/4 BSPP, allowing for compatibility with standard hydraulic fittings. Constructed from 6061T651 aluminum, the manifold offers excellent corrosion resistance and durability without the need for anodizing, which can affect fatigue life negatively. The aluminum construction ensures that the manifold withstands pressures up to 3000 psi (210 bar), making it suitable for medium-pressure applications in hydraulic systems. The design considerations focus on maintaining structural integrity while providing efficient fluid control in various environments. This Sun Hydraulics WFP model serves as an essential component in systems requiring reliable fluid distribution and control, particularly where space constraints necessitate compact and efficient solutions. Its straightforward design allows for easy integration into existing systems without compromising performance or reliability.

Notes:
- Important: Carefully consider the maximum system pressure. The pressure rating of the manifold is dependent on the manifold material, with the port type/size a secondary consideration. Manifolds constructed of aluminum are not rated for pressures higher than 3000 psi (210 bar), regardless of the port type/size specified.
